Summary : Additional plugins that interact with konqueror
Description :
Some additional plugins that interact with konqueror
* adblock: AdBlock plugin
* akregator: Add feeds directly to akregator (kdepim is needed)
* autorefresh: Refresh websites after a specifig period
* babelfish: Translate a website with babelfish
* crashes: Crash monitor
* dirfilter: Filter the current directory in many ways
* domtreeviewer: Displays the document object model in a box
* fsview: Graphical Disk Usage for inode/directory
* imagerotation: service menu to image operations
* khtmlsettingsplugin: Enable/disable some HTML settings
* kimggalleryplugin: Creates an HTML page with thumbnails of
all the images in the current directory.
* mediarealfolder: service menu to open a medium mountpoints
* minitools: Implement bookmarklets into konqueror
* rellinks: Allows access to relations defined in the header of a document
* searchbar: Search Bar
* sidebar: a small embedded mediaplayer, for songs/video preview
* smbmounter: provides two menus items to smbmount/umount samba shares
* uachanger: Change the user agent for websites
* validators: Website validators
* webarchiver: Web Archiver
